ProcedureEdit

One can apply for a divorce through appointments only.

Apply In-Person

  1. To apply for a divorce, the applicant must approach the Egyptian Consulate URL and obtain all necessary documents for the divorce.
  2. Submit your application along with all other requirements to The Egyptian Consulate.
  3. Once the notice of the granting of the divorce is received, the parties may bring the endorsement of the divorce to the office where the marriage was registered.
  4. Amicable divorce, both parties agree to divorce, go together to the registrar, sign and give their fingerprints, it’s effective immediately, Husband cannot take his wife back without her consent, wife cannot remarry anyone else (other than original husband) for 3 months OR until she gives birth if she’s pregnant, after that she’s free to remarry whomever she pleases that is the Egyptian Muslim law.
  5. Divorce in Absentia, where the husband unilaterally divorces the wife.
  6. Divorce can be revoked also unilaterally in this case without the wife’s consent within the three months waiting period (unless it’s this couple’s third consecutive divorce).
  7. if your husband went on his own to divorce this turns to be a divorce in absentia and if he can change his mind without the consent of the wife this will be done within 3 months (in some jurisdictions it is 4 months and 10 days, and if the wife is pregnant it is until she gives birth).
  8. Forced divorces, where a woman lets go of all her rights in return for a divorce by a judge. Doesn’t take much time or money.
  9. The judge’s ruling is final and cannot be appealed in any way.
  10. Court divorce at the request of the wife due to damages (financial, physical, emotional …etc.), complicated, takes a long time. Husband can appeal and it can be quite lengthy (Years long).
  11. So in brief, wife cannot unilaterally divorce and it’s quite difficult.
  12. For Christian divorce it is even more complex and difficult since it can be sometimes impossible even if both parties agree to divorce.
  13. In all cases even if you are Christian but he is Muslim (or Christian with a different sect), Muslim law will apply in that case.
  14. The wife here is usually – by law – the winner in divorce.
  15. Husband has to pay deferred dowry, (unless she waives his rights if she’s the one who insisted on divorce), child support, housing (if his ex has children with him. Wives usually don’t pay anything to the husband even if she has more money than the man.

Required DocumentsEdit

  • Original & valid Egyptian National ID or Passport.
  • 5 personal photos each (white background).
  • Original Egyptian Birth Certificates (or a certified copy), in case one of the couple is non-Egyptian, please legalize and translate your Birth Certificate from your respective Country’s Embassy/Consulate.
  • Original marriage certificates.
  • Divorce Certificates (in case it is a second/third marriage).
  • 2 witnesses with original and valid Egyptian National ID or Passport.

EligibilityEdit

  • Divorce applicants have to be both Egyptians, or at least one of them.
  • Male applicants must be 18 years or older, 16 or older for females.


FeesEdit

Fees are 205 USD or 3224.77 Egyptian Pound.

ValidityEdit

The divorce certificate is valid for lifetime.

InstructionsEdit

  • The Egyptian consulate will not process any divorce process without the presence of the spouse, if the spouse resides in Egypt, the husband may authorize someone to divorce the spouse on his behalf, by giving him a Power of Attorney.
  • The Consulate only legalizes Divorce Court Orders authenticated by the Ministry of Foreign Affairs in Cairo.

Information which might helpEdit

  • The divorcing husband can reinstate his wife during the waiting period (about three months before divorce is final).
  • If the waiting period is over, the divorcing husband cannot reinstate his wife without a new marriage contract and a new dowry
  • If the husband divorces his wife for the second time, he can reinstate her again as a wife under the previous condition.
  • If the husband divorces his wife for the third time, he cannot reinstate her unless she weds another man and then gets divorced or widowed
  • If your husband is Muslim, the Muslim law applies visa vase for Christians also.
  • If your husband is of a different religions and/or sects, Muslim law will apply.
  • Until the waiting period is over it is not the final period for the two parties, the marriage remain in existence the man can take back his his wife .But after the waiting period is over,
  • if the did if the husband did not take back the wife, it becomes automatically final divorce.
  • Any wife who decide to marry before the expiration of the waiting time and decide to get married to someone else during the waiting period is illegal polygamy punishable by prison.
